Given below are two statements : one is labelled as Assertion and the other is labelled as Reason. Assertion: The ionic radii of O 2 - and Mg 2 + are same. Reason: Both O 2 - and Mg 2 + are isoelectronic species. In the light of the above statements, choose the correct answer from the options given below.

Options

  1. ABoth Assertion and Reason are true and Reason is the correct explanation of Assertion.
  2. BBoth Assertion and Reason are true but Reason is not the correct explanation of Assertion.
  3. CAssertion is true but Reason is false.
  4. DAssertion is false but Reason is true.

Correct answer

D. Assertion is false but Reason is true.

Step-by-step solution

Both Mg 2 + and O - 2 have 10 electrons each and they are isoelectronic species. But the size of O - 2 is greater than Mg 2 + as size ∝ 1 z e z e of Mg 2 + = 12 10 = 1 . 2 z e of O - 2 = 8 10 = 0 . 8 z e = Number of protons Number of electrons
